After its successful trial run with over 150 participants earlier this year, Bike Rave Auckland is back. Organisers attest that a bike rave is a simple concept. All participants need do is pimp up their bicycles with as many lights as they can get their hands on (blinkies, highflalutin LED wonderlights, or simply two dollar shop glow sticks zip tied to helmets and spokes), get together with a bunch of people, and ride along the waterfront accompanied by some excellent, synchronised tunes.

There’s no snobbery at bike raves, bikes old and new and riders of all ages and skill levels are welcome. It’s an event based on fun. The Bike Rave was inspired by the incredibly successful bike raves held in Vancouver, which have been called an "annual glowtastic mobile dance party on wheels" by Huffington Post, and involved over a thousand participants in decked-out bikes.

Organisers of the New Zealand version are a group of Aucklanders who love their bikes and want to bring some fun biking events from offshore to New Zealand for kiwis to enjoy. With rewards, fluro, lights and music what on earth would make you not want to get amongst this two-wheelin’ fun?
